Scalability
Outsourcing allows you to scale your software development outsourcing resources up or down as needed. You can easily adjust the size of your development team based on the demands of your projects, without the need for long-term commitments.
Focus on Core Business Activities
Outsourcing software development frees up your internal resources to focus on core business activities. Your team can concentrate on the activities that generate revenue and add value to your business, while leaving the software development to the experts.
What to Consider When Outsourcing
When outsourcing software development, there are several factors to consider:
Communication
Communication is critical when outsourcing software development. You need to ensure that your outsourcing partner understands your requirements and can communicate effectively with your team. Regular communication can help you stay up-to-date on the progress of your project and address any issues that arise.
Quality Assurance
Quality assurance is essential when outsourcing software development. You need to ensure that the software meets your quality standards and is free of defects. This requires regular testing and feedback throughout the development process.